Section D Achievements and performance This was the sixth year of the Foundation's work and our activities in the above areas continued as those of our fifth year. Section E Financial review The foundation is entirely operated by volunteers and has no overhead costs and accordingly has no requirement for a specific reserves policy. The trustees consider that the unrestricted funds of £15333 held at the yearend are sufficient. Responsibllltles and basls of report As th8 charity's trustees, you are responsible for the preparation of the accounts in accordan with the requirements of the Charf(ies Act 2011 (Ihe Act?. I report in respect of my examinatlon of the Trust's accounts carried out under section 145 of the 2011 Act and in carrying out my 8xamination. I have followed all the applicable Directions given by the Charty Commission under section 145(5){b) of the Act. Independent examlnerfs ststsment I have completed my examination. I confinm that no material matters have come to my attention in connection with the examination which gives me use to believe that in, any material respect.. the accounting records were not kept in accordance with section 130 of the Charities Act., or the aOUnts did not accord with the accounting records., or the accounts did not comply with the applicable requirements conMIng the form and content of accounts set out in the Charities (Accounts and Reports) Regulations 2008 other than any requirement that the accounts give a 'true and fail view which is not a matter considered as part of an independent examination. I have no concerns and have come across no other matters in connection with the examination to which attention should be drawn in this report in order to enable a proper understanding of the accounts to be reached.
